📌  相关文章
📜  如何使用 jQuery 遍历 div 的子元素?(1)

📅  最后修改于: 2023-12-03 15:23:56.094000             🧑  作者: Mango

如何使用 jQuery 遍历 div 的子元素?

在网页开发中,经常需要操作 HTML 元素及其属性。而 jQuery 是一个非常流行的 JavaScript 库,能够简化我们的 DOM 操作。本文将介绍如何使用 jQuery 遍历 div 的子元素。

遍历子元素

在 jQuery 中,可以使用 children() 方法来获取指定元素的当前元素下所有子元素。该方法返回一个 jQuery 对象,因此可以继续调用其他 jQuery 方法来操作子元素。

$('#myDiv').children().each(function() {
  console.log($(this).text());
});

以上代码演示了如何使用 each() 方法遍历子元素,并输出它们的文本内容。在遍历过程中,this 代表当前子元素,可以使用 $() 创建 jQuery 对象。

筛选特定子元素

有时候,我们需要筛选出特定的子元素进行操作。可以使用 find() 方法来筛选符合条件的子元素。该方法接收一个选择器作为参数,返回一个包含所有匹配元素的 jQuery 对象。

$('#myDiv').find('.myClass').css('color', 'red');

以上代码演示了如何使用 find() 方法来筛选出所有 class 为 myClass 的子元素,并将它们的字体颜色设置为红色。

总结

使用 jQuery 遍历 div 的子元素非常简单,只需要调用 children() 方法或者 find() 方法即可。此外,通过这两个方法可以结合其他 jQuery 方法来实现更强大的功能,比如添加、移除、修改子元素等操作。